格式无损转换颠覆传统:BabelDOC重新定义学术PDF翻译范式
当神经科学研究员李教授尝试翻译最新发表的EEG信号分析论文时,LaTeX公式在转换后变成乱码,图表位置完全错乱——这是全球科研工作者在跨语言文献处理中普遍面临的困境。传统翻译工具将PDF视为纯文本处理,忽略学术文档特有的排版逻辑,导致格式还原率不足60%。BabelDOC通过深度优化的PDF解析引擎与术语管理系统,构建了"格式无损转换"的技术新标准,彻底改变学术翻译的工作流程。
问题发现:学术翻译的三重技术壁垒
在粒子物理实验室,王博士团队曾因翻译后的论文中矩阵公式错位,导致国际合作审稿延误三周。这种格式失真源于传统工具的底层缺陷:PDF解析时将文本与格式信息分离处理,无法识别学术文档特有的层级结构。通过[format/pdf/midend/layout_parser.py]模块的逆向分析可见,学术PDF包含文本流、字体样式、坐标系统等12类复杂对象,普通翻译工具仅能处理其中3类基础信息。
专业术语翻译的准确性同样堪忧。计算机科学领域的"哈希表"常被误译为"散列表",这种术语混乱源于通用翻译引擎缺乏学科专属词库。神经语言学研究显示,术语不一致会使文献理解效率降低47%。而多文件批量处理时,传统工具平均每100页文档出现23处格式错误,迫使研究人员花费大量时间手动校对。
方案创新:三大核心突破重构翻译技术
BabelDOC的革命性突破在于建立"结构优先"的翻译框架。通过[babeldoc/format/pdf/translation_config.py]实现的PDF语义解析引擎,能够识别标题层级、公式区域、图表关联等学术文档特征,格式还原准确率提升至98.7%。该引擎采用基于深度学习的版面分析模型,在保持原文排版逻辑的同时,实现译文的自然流动。
💡 首创"术语生态系统"解决专业词汇统一难题。[translator/cache.py]模块构建双向术语记忆机制,支持12个学科的预定义术语集,用户上传的CSV词汇表可实时生效。系统会自动检测并替换跨文档的术语变体,确保"convolutional neural network"在全项目中始终译为"卷积神经网络"。
针对科研团队的协作需求,[utils/priority_thread_pool_executor.py]实现的智能任务调度系统,将多文件处理效率提升3倍。该模块根据文档复杂度动态分配计算资源,在8核服务器上可并行处理20篇论文,同时保持内存占用稳定在600MB以内。
格式转换效果:左为英文原文,右为保留原始排版的中文译文,公式、图表位置误差控制在0.5mm以内
实践指南:三阶操作解锁高效翻译流程
单篇论文精准翻译
预处理阶段需检查PDF文本可复制性,对扫描件启用OCR增强功能,系统会自动调用[docvision/table_detection/rapidocr.py]进行文本提取。配置环节在术语管理界面选择"神经科学"专业包,并导入实验室自定义词汇表。执行翻译时通过进度监控面板实时查看处理状态,完成后使用内置对比工具验证关键数据图表的位置准确性。
文献综述批量处理
面对30篇参考文献合集,先通过"批量导入"功能建立项目,在[format/pdf/split_manager.py]支持下按章节自动拆分文档。配置全局术语库时启用"跨文档一致性检查",确保核心概念翻译统一。执行阶段系统会智能分配CPU资源,完成后生成翻译质量报告,包含术语一致性评分与格式还原度检测结果。
协作翻译与版本控制
团队协作场景中,项目负责人通过Web界面分配翻译任务,协作者在[translator/translator.py]驱动的在线编辑器中完成译文。系统自动记录修改痕迹,支持术语库实时同步。验证环节可通过双语对照模式进行逐页校对,最终生成符合期刊要求的PDF格式文件。
格式转换协作系统:支持多人实时编辑术语库与翻译结果审核,术语变更响应延迟低于2秒
价值升华:从效率工具到知识传播基础设施
BabelDOC将研究人员从繁琐的格式调整中解放出来,平均节省80%的文档处理时间。某高校医学团队使用后,文献综述产出效率提升3倍,术语一致性错误率下降92%。这种效率提升不仅加速科研进程,更打破了学术知识的语言壁垒。
在知识传播维度,该工具使发展中国家研究机构能更准确地获取前沿成果,某东南亚大学通过BabelDOC将英文论文翻译成本地语言后,学术引用量增长45%。通过[format/pdf/midend/automatic_term_extractor.py]模块,系统还能自动生成多语言术语对照表,为跨文化学术交流提供基础数据。
从实验室到全球科研社区,BabelDOC正通过技术创新重新定义学术文档翻译的标准,让知识突破语言与格式的限制,自由流动。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0199
cann-learning-hubCANN 学习中心仓,支持在线互动运行、边学边练,提供教程、示例与优化方案,一站式助力昇腾开发者快速上手。Jupyter Notebook0130
MiMo-V2.5-Pro-FP4-DFlashMiMo-V2.5-Pro-FP4-DFlash 是驱动 MiMo-V2.5-Pro-UltraSpeed 的底层模型: FP4 量化骨干网络:对 MoE 专家采用 MXFP4 量化,同时保持模型其他部分的更高精度,在几乎无损质量的前提下,显著减小模型体积并降低内存带宽压力。 BF16 DFlash 草稿生成器:用于块扩散推测解码,每次前向传播可生成一整个块的 tokens,并让骨干网络一步完成验证。 两者协同作用,既降低了每参数的位宽,又减少了骨干网络前向传播的次数,而这两者正是万亿参数模型解码过程中的两大主要成本来源。Python00
JoyAI-EchoJoyAI-Echo,这是一个独立的、仅用于推理的版本,旨在实现分钟级多镜头音视频生成。它采用了经过蒸馏的DMD生成器、配对的跨模态记忆以及故事级别的一致性。其性能的核心在于,一个跨模态视听记忆库能够在长达五分钟的视频中保持角色外观和语音音色的一致性。同时,一个训练后处理流程将基于记忆的强化学习与分布匹配蒸馏相结合,实现了7.5倍的速度提升,显著增强了视觉质量和对齐效果。00
AstrBot✨ 易上手的多平台 LLM 聊天机器人及开发框架 ✨ 平台支持 QQ、QQ频道、Telegram、微信、企微、飞书 | OpenAI、DeepSeek、Gemini、硅基流动、月之暗面、Ollama、OneAPI、Dify 等。附带 WebUI。Python08
handy-ollama动手学Ollama,CPU玩转大模型部署,在线阅读地址:https://datawhalechina.github.io/handy-ollama/Jupyter Notebook07